Make-Ahead Protein Oatmeal Bake for Busy Mornings

  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

Description

This Make-Ahead Protein Oatmeal Bake is the ultimate breakfast solution for busy mornings. Packed with protein and customizable mix-ins, it delivers a warm, satisfying start to your day without any morning effort. Perfect for meal prep and family breakfasts.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ups Old-Fashioned Rolled Oats
  • 1/2 cup Protein Powder (vanilla or unflavored)
  • 2 cups Milk (any variety)
  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1/4 cup Maple Syrup
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Powder
  • 1 teaspoon C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 cup Mix-ins of Choice (blueberries, walnuts, etc.)


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ease an 8×8 inch baking dish.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together oats, protein powder,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t.
  3. In a separate bowl, whisk eggs, milk, maple syrup, and vanilla extract until combined.
  4. Pour wet ingredients into d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Gently fold in mix-ins.
  5. Pour batter into pr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
  6. Bake for 35-40 minutes until top is golden brown and center is set.
  7. Let cool in pan for 10-15 minutes before slicing.

Notes

For extra flavor, sprinkle with cinnamon and drizzle with maple syrup before baking. Store in refrigerator for up to 5 days or freeze for up to 3 months. Reheat in microwave for 30-60 seconds or in toaster oven for crispier texture.
